Monthly Cost of Living
🙂A single person spends $1,023 per month in Bansko vs $1,073 in Lovech,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$1,548 per month in Bansko vs $1,632 in Lovech,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$2,073 per month in Bansko vs $2,191 in Lovech, rent included.
🙂Bansko is about 5% cheaper than Lovech,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.
📊Both Bansko and Lovech are more affordable than the global median – Bansko23% lower, Lovech20% lower.
